Allison Glass New Resource Development Coordinator for United Way of Knox County

Please join us in welcoming Allison Glass as our new Resource Development Coordinator.

Joining the United Way team, Allison brings knowledge and experience in the nonprofit arena, having previously served with Main Street Mount Vernon and the Girl Scouts of North East Ohio.

With a background in journalism and digital media from Ashland University, she has found enthusiasm in community connections and service. Allison is very excited to be able to stay in her hometown of Mount Vernon and Knox County and support the mission of the United Way, connecting neighbors in need to vital resources, in the community that raised her.

Serving as the Resource Development Coordinator, Allison will lead the annual campaign; planning and coordinating all the fundraising that goes to support the three main initiatives of the United Way: education, health, and financial stability. Allison will also take on a leadership role with the United Way affinity group Women United – United Way of Knox County, Ohio Inc, which is a natural fit for her, as she is passionate about women empowering themselves and their communities.

“We are excited to bring Allison on board to the United Way team,” said Kelly Brenneman, executive director of the United Way of Knox County. “She has experience with the Knox County community and will bring a new energy to this role. She is a fantastic addition to our team.”
